This video demonstrates practicing the GSSF National Challenge Course of Fire, a 50-shot competition shot at distances from 5 to 25 yards with a 15-second time limit per 10-shot string. The instructor uses a Glock 44 and explains target scoring, emphasizing the need to clear malfunctions with a tap-rack-bang procedure. The course is noted for its simplicity and potential to win a firearm.
